We the undersigned petition the Royal Borough of Windsor & Maidenhead to discontiue long term contracts for the eastern half of Alexandra Gardens preventing public access to the lawns.

Mental health is a massive issue in 2025 with social media demanding our attention every 5 seconds. Residents need Alexandra Gardens back for the people of Windsor to get away from the hustle and bustle and enjoy some mindfulness.

Random weekend usage for big events that pay a full licence fee, or no fee if a community event, is great but 3 month contracts to any single contractor, allowing them to dominate the public space to the eastern half of Alexandra Gardens should be discouraged and discontinued.

Started by: Jonathan Davey

This ePetition runs from 08/02/2025 to 08/05/2025.
